What they do
A Medical Secretary provides secretarial work that requires specialized knowledge of medical terminology and procedures, insurance and billing processes and medical records management. Works with physicians and other clinicians. May gather intake information from patients scheduled for appointments at an office.

GENERAL SUMMARY
Under general supervision from the Division Head or Physician-in-Charge or Vice President, in Leadership Salary GradeM08/ PHY
500 or above, provides secretarial and administrative support services in addition to medical operations support. Utilizes knowledge of medical terminology and processes in a clinical environment. Duties require a thorough knowledge of supervisor's areas of responsibility in order to gather data and prepare reports, answer correspondence, conduct projects, and so forth. May direct the work of lower-classified clerical employees, purchase standard supplies, and perform routine bookkeeping and billing functions.EDUCATION/EXPERIENCE REQUIRED
Requires a High School Diploma or a G.E.D. equivalent. One (1) year certificate from college or technical school with at least three (3) years of experience within an office setting; or five (5) or more years of related secretarial experience within an office setting required. Previous experience scheduling appointments/maintaining calendars required. Progressively more responsible related work experience necessary in order to gain in-depth understanding or organizational policies, procedures and operations, in order to assume a variety of high-level administrative details including arranging meetings and conferences without prior clearance, answering semi-complex correspondence, assembling highly confidential and sensitive information, answering questions of influential callers, and so forth. Proficient with medical terminology. Interpersonal skills necessary in order to effectively communicate with external and internal callers and visitors, often dealing with sensitive/highly confidential matters. Analytical skills necessary in order to handle semi-complex administrative details such as preparing special non-recurring reports by combining confidential data from several sources, and scheduling and handling administrative/secretarial needs of supervisor.Additional Information Organization:
